Job Summary
In this role, you will develop tailored software for processing and visualizing test and flight data, utilizing modern web technologies while significantly supporting the engineering team.
Job Technologies
Your role in the team
- Your main objective will be to design, develop, and integrate our in-house software used to process, visualize, and analyze test, launch, and flight data.
- The software you develop empowers our engineering and operations teams to work with live and post-flight data of the vehicle prior, during, and after take-off.
- Build and maintain complex web applications.
- Create applications to allow the monitoring of real time data with different types of visualization.
- Develop on top of design systems and create libraries to allow reusing their components.
- Improve general performance and responsiveness.
- Author technical and user documentation.
- Contribute to architectural decisions based on trade-off analysis.
- Guide less experienced engineers sharing your knowledge and know-how.

This is your employer
Isar Aerospace
Isar Aerospace is an innovative German aerospace company specializing in the development and manufacturing of launch vehicles for satellite transport. With a focus on small and medium satellites, the company offers flexible launch configurations and aims to make access to space more cost-effective.
